WebApr 13, 2024 · Hamlet is the Prince of Denmark and the son of the murdered King Hamlet and the Queen, Gertrude. The conversation with the gravedigger suggests that Hamlet is 30 years old, although he is still a student, at the University of Wittenberg. William Shakespeare's famous work " Hamlet, Prince of Denmark" is a tragedy set across five acts written around the year 1600. More than just a revenge play, "Hamlet" deals with questions about life and existence, sanity, love, death, and betrayal.
